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Grow, learn, socialize and even work through Op...
Search
Joe Cohen
November 18, 2016
Programming
0
28
Grow, learn, socialize and even work through Open Source
Joe Cohen
November 18, 2016
Tweet
Share
More Decks by Joe Cohen
See All by Joe Cohen
Crece, aprende, socializa y hasta trabaja a través de Open Source
joecohens
0
180
Código limpio sin loops
joecohens
2
240
Other Decks in Programming
See All in Programming
AI Agents: How Do They Work and How to Build Them @ Shift 2025
slobodan
0
100
AIでLINEスタンプを作ってみた
eycjur
1
230
Updates on MLS on Ruby (and maybe more)
sylph01
1
180
Reading Rails 1.0 Source Code
okuramasafumi
0
250
250830 IaCの選定~AWS SAMのLambdaをECSに乗り換えたときの備忘録~
east_takumi
0
400
Navigation 2 を 3 に移行する(予定)ためにやったこと
yokomii
0
350
AI Coding Agentのセキュリティリスク:PRの自己承認とメルカリの対策
s3h
0
240
@Environment(\.keyPath)那么好我不允许你们不知道! / atEnvironment keyPath is so good and you should know it!
lovee
0
130
Android 16 × Jetpack Composeで縦書きテキストエディタを作ろう / Vertical Text Editor with Compose on Android 16
cc4966
2
270
testingを眺める
matumoto
1
140
「待たせ上手」なスケルトンスクリーン、 そのUXの裏側
teamlab
PRO
0
570
複雑なドメインに挑む.pdf
yukisakai1225
5
1.2k
Featured
See All Featured
We Have a Design System, Now What?
morganepeng
53
7.8k
What’s in a name? Adding method to the madness
productmarketing
PRO
23
3.7k
[Rails World 2023 - Day 1 Closing Keynote] - The Magic of Rails
eileencodes
36
2.5k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
15
1.7k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
285
14k
XXLCSS - How to scale CSS and keep your sanity
sugarenia
248
1.3M
Bootstrapping a Software Product
garrettdimon
PRO
307
110k
Done Done
chrislema
185
16k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
34
6k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
188
55k
Unsuck your backbone
ammeep
671
58k
How to Ace a Technical Interview
jacobian
279
23k
Transcript
"Grow, learn, socialize and even work through Open Source" Joseph
Cohen @joecohens
A little bit about me... CEO @Shoperti & CTO @dinkbit
Just because you're a great computer scientist, doesn't mean you're
a great software writer. 1 dhh (David Heinemeier Hansson)
Reading code it's not enough to write better code. 1
Unknown
Sources of life for programmers
Sources of life for programmers 4 Google
Sources of life for programmers 4 Google 4 StackOverflow
Sources of life for programmers 4 Google 4 StackOverflow 4
GitHub
None
Try and error lifecycle
None
How to start?
Searching for the ideal project Based on a real story
Tips
Tips 4 People
Tips 4 People 4 Like
Tips 4 People 4 Like 4 Interest
Tips 4 People 4 Like 4 Interest 4 Tech
Tips 4 People 4 Like 4 Interest 4 Tech 4
Bug fix
My personal best social network
Pull Request
Pull Request 4 Review changes
Pull Request 4 Review changes 4 Compare changes
Pull Request 4 Review changes 4 Compare changes 4 Discuss
modifications or features
Pull Request 4 Review changes 4 Compare changes 4 Discuss
modifications or features 4 Keep working on a change until it's done
Fear
None
Start with something simple
None
None
None
None
Second Try
None
None
None
None
None
Third try New feature
None
None
None
Mentor
None
None
None
Learn ¿What's next?
None
None
None
None
None
None
None
None
Open Souce ❤ Keep going level up
None
None
None
None
Project
AltThree
AltThree 4 15 repos públicos
AltThree 4 15 repos públicos 4 20+ repos privados
AltThree 4 15 repos públicos 4 20+ repos privados 4
1 proyecto SaaS
AltThree 4 15 repos públicos 4 20+ repos privados 4
1 proyecto SaaS 4 1 proyecto medio conocido
Resumen
Resumen 4 Give back to the community
Resumen 4 Give back to the community 4 Leave fear
out, we are all equal
Resumen 4 Give back to the community 4 Leave fear
out, we are all equal 4 Start with something simple
Resumen 4 Give back to the community 4 Leave fear
out, we are all equal 4 Start with something simple 4 Create or participate in community
Resumen 4 Give back to the community 4 Leave fear
out, we are all equal 4 Start with something simple 4 Create or participate in community 4 Learn based on experiences
Resumen 4 Give back to the community 4 Leave fear
out, we are all equal 4 Start with something simple 4 Create or participate in community 4 Learn based on experiences 4 Grow sharing with others
DON'T STOP WRITING
Do what you like best and you will do amazing
things 1 Joseph Cohen
Gracias Joseph Cohen @joecohens CEO @Shoperti & CTO @dinkbit